Firefighters were called to Noble's Hospital last night after a fire at the Grainagh Court facility.
Half of it had to be evacuated due to the blaze which started at 9.40pm.
The Department of Health and Social Care says the cause of the fire is not yet known and it would not be wise to speculate at this time.
No patients or staff were injured - the facility is now open and operational.
